阅读量:3
strings 命令是 Linux 系统中的一个文本处理工具,它可以从二进制文件中提取可打印的字符串。这个命令通常用于分析程序、库文件或其他二进制文件,以查找可能包含的文本信息,如错误消息、文件路径、版本号等。
关于您的问题,“Linux strings命令能否提取网络数据”,答案是否定的。strings 命令本身并不直接处理网络数据或从网络流中提取信息。它的主要功能是从本地存储的二进制文件中提取字符串。
如果您需要从网络数据中提取信息,您可能需要使用其他工具或方法,例如:
- 网络抓包工具:如
tcpdump或Wireshark,这些工具可以捕获和分析网络流量,从而提取所需的数据。 - 编程语言库:许多编程语言提供了处理网络数据的库,如 Python 的
socket库或 Java 的java.net包。这些库允许您编写自定义程序来捕获和处理网络数据。 - 命令行工具:某些命令行工具也可以用于处理网络数据,如
grep(用于搜索文本模式)或awk(用于文本处理)。
总之,虽然 strings 命令在提取二进制文件中的文本信息方面非常有用,但它并不适用于直接处理网络数据。
以上就是关于“Linux strings命令能否提取网络数据”的相关介绍,筋斗云是国内较早的云主机应用的服务商,拥有10余年行业经验,提供丰富的云服务器、租用服务器等相关产品服务。云服务器资源弹性伸缩,主机vCPU、内存性能强悍、超高I/O速度、故障秒级恢复;电子化备案,提交快速,专业团队7×24小时服务支持!
简单好用、高性价比云服务器租用链接:https://www.jindouyun.cn/product/cvm